Key Ingredients for Easy Garden Blender Salsa

Easy Garden Blender Salsa

The ingredients in this Easy Garden Blender Salsa come together beautifully, creating a medley of flavors that reflect the essence of summer. Fresh tomatoes provide a juicy base, while the zing from lime juice and the heat from jalapeño create a perfect balance. Each component contributes to an explosion of taste that enhances any dish.

  • 1/2 medium red onion (divided): Adds a sweet and slightly pungent flavor that complements the other ingredients.
  • 1 jalapeño (seeded): Brings a spicy kick to the salsa; adjust the seeds for desired heat.
  • 1 lime (juice from lime): Gives a refreshing tang that brightens up the flavors.
  • 3 cloves garlic (crushed): Provides a rich depth of flavor that enhances the entire dish.
  • 5 Roma or Plum tomatoes (halved, seeds removed): The star ingredient, offering sweetness and juiciness.
  • 1 tsp Kosher salt: Essential for enhancing the natural flavors of all ingredients.
  • 1/2 tsp sugar: Balances the acidity of the tomatoes and lime juice.
  • cilantro (about half a bunch): Adds a fresh, herbaceous note that ties the salsa together.

Recipe Directions for Easy Garden Blender Salsa

Easy Garden Blender Salsa

Getting started with this recipe is wonderfully simple. You’ll be amazed at how quickly you can whip up this Easy Garden Blender Salsa! Follow these easy steps, and you’ll have a delicious salsa ready to enjoy.

  1. Begin by preparing your ingredients. Take the red onion and slice it in half. You’ll only need half for this recipe, so set the other half aside for later use. The red onion will give your salsa a sweet and slightly tangy flavor, which is essential.
  2. Next, grab your jalapeño. Carefully cut it in half and remove the seeds if you want a milder salsa. If you love heat, feel free to leave some seeds in! This little pepper will add just the right amount of kick.
  3. Now, it’s time for the lime. Cut it in half and squeeze out the juice into a bowl. Make sure to remove any seeds that might fall in! The lime juice will brighten up the flavors of your salsa.
  4. Take your garlic and crush it with the side of your knife, then chop it finely. This will release all the aromatic oils and bring a wonderful flavor to the salsa.
  5. Now, let’s move on to the tomatoes. Slice each one in half and remove the seeds. This will prevent your salsa from being too watery. After that, chop them into quarters, ready to blend.
  6. Gather all the prepared ingredients: the red onion, jalapeño, lime juice, and garlic. Place them into your blender.
  7. Add the remaining half of the red onion, the chopped tomatoes, Kosher salt, sugar, and a handful of cilantro into the blender. Don’t skimp on the cilantro; it brings freshness that elevates the whole dish!
  8. Cover the blender with the lid and pulse the mixture a few times until it reaches your desired consistency. I like a bit of texture, but if you prefer it smoother, just blend longer.
  9. Once blended, taste your salsa. You can always adjust the seasoning with a little more salt or sugar if needed. This is your salsa, so make it just how you like it!
  10. For the best flavor, I recommend refrigerating your salsa for a few hours.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ully, but you can also serve it immediately if you can’t wait!
  11.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Enjoy your fresh Easy Garden Blender Salsa with chips, tacos, or as a topping for grilled chicken.

Things Worth Knowing

  • Quality Ingredients: Always use the freshest ingredients you can find. The better your vegetables, the more flavorful your salsa will be.
  • Balancing Flavors: Adjust the amounts of salt and sugar to balance the acidity of the tomatoes and brightness of the lime.
  • Consistency: For a chunkier salsa, pulse less. For a smoother salsa, blend longer.
  • Chill Time: Allowing the salsa to chill enhances its flavor by letting the ingredients meld together.

Recipe Variations about Easy Garden Blender Salsa

Easy Garden Blender Salsa

This Easy Garden Blender Salsa is incredibly adaptable! Here are some variations you can try to mix things up and keep the flavors fresh.

  • Fruity Twist: Add diced mango or pineapple for a sweet and fruity salsa.
  • Spicy Kick: Mix in more jalapeños or even some diced serrano peppers for a fiery version.
  • Black Bean Add-in: For a heartier salsa, throw in some black beans. They add protein and fiber, making the salsa more filling.
  • Avocado Salsa: Blend in avocado for a creamy and rich twist. It adds healthy fats and smoothness.
  • Herb Variations: Try swapping out the cilantro for fresh parsley or adding other herbs like basil for a unique flavor.
  • Roasted Version: Roast the tomatoes and jalapeños before blending for a smoky flavor profile.
